cisco_ios_xr_alarmgr_server_oper_alarms_detail_detail_card_detail_locations_detail_location_active

package
v0.1.1 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Jan 30, 2019 License: Apache-2.0 Imports: 3 Imported by: 0

Documentation

Overview

Cisco-IOS-XR-alarmgr-server-oper:alarms/detail/detail-card/detail-locations/detail-location/active

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type AlarmMgrShowAlarmData

type AlarmMgrShowAlarmData struct {
	// Alarm description
	Description string `protobuf:"bytes,1,opt,name=description,proto3" json:"description,omitempty"`
	// Alarm location
	Location string `protobuf:"bytes,2,opt,name=location,proto3" json:"location,omitempty"`
	// Alarm aid
	Aid string `protobuf:"bytes,3,opt,name=aid,proto3" json:"aid,omitempty"`
	// Alarm tag description
	Tag string `protobuf:"bytes,4,opt,name=tag,proto3" json:"tag,omitempty"`
	// Alarm module description
	Module string `protobuf:"bytes,5,opt,name=module,proto3" json:"module,omitempty"`
	// Alarm eid
	Eid string `protobuf:"bytes,6,opt,name=eid,proto3" json:"eid,omitempty"`
	// Reporting agent id
	ReportingAgentId uint32 `protobuf:"varint,7,opt,name=reporting_agent_id,json=reportingAgentId,proto3" json:"reporting_agent_id,omitempty"`
	// Pending async flag
	PendingSync bool `protobuf:"varint,8,opt,name=pending_sync,json=pendingSync,proto3" json:"pending_sync,omitempty"`
	// Alarm severity
	Severity string `protobuf:"bytes,9,opt,name=severity,proto3" json:"severity,omitempty"`
	// Alarm status
	Status string `protobuf:"bytes,10,opt,name=status,proto3" json:"status,omitempty"`
	// Alarm group
	Group string `protobuf:"bytes,11,opt,name=group,proto3" json:"group,omitempty"`
	// Alarm set time
	SetTime string `protobuf:"bytes,12,opt,name=set_time,json=setTime,proto3" json:"set_time,omitempty"`
	// Alarm set time(timestamp format)
	SetTimestamp uint64 `protobuf:"varint,13,opt,name=set_timestamp,json=setTimestamp,proto3" json:"set_timestamp,omitempty"`
	// Alarm clear time
	ClearTime string `protobuf:"bytes,14,opt,name=clear_time,json=clearTime,proto3" json:"clear_time,omitempty"`
	// Alarm clear time(timestamp format)
	ClearTimestamp uint64 `protobuf:"varint,15,opt,name=clear_timestamp,json=clearTimestamp,proto3" json:"clear_timestamp,omitempty"`
	// Alarm service affecting
	ServiceAffecting string `protobuf:"bytes,16,opt,name=service_affecting,json=serviceAffecting,proto3" json:"service_affecting,omitempty"`
	// OTN feature specific alarm attributes
	Otn *AlarmOtn `protobuf:"bytes,17,opt,name=otn,proto3" json:"otn,omitempty"`
	// TCA feature specific alarm attributes
	Tca *AlarmTca `protobuf:"bytes,18,opt,name=tca,proto3" json:"tca,omitempty"`
	// alarm_event_type
	Type string `protobuf:"bytes,19,opt,name=type,proto3" json:"type,omitempty"`
	// Alarm interface name
	Interface string `protobuf:"bytes,20,opt,name=interface,proto3" json:"interface,omitempty"`
	// Alarm name
	AlarmName            string   `protobuf:"bytes,21,opt,name=alarm_name,json=alarmName,proto3" json:"alarm_name,omitempty"`
	XXX_NoUnkeyedLiteral struct{} `json:"-"`
	XXX_unrecognized     []byte   `json:"-"`
	XXX_sizecache        int32    `json:"-"`
}

Alarm mgr show alarm data

func (*AlarmMgrShowAlarmData) Descriptor

func (*AlarmMgrShowAlarmData) Descriptor() ([]byte, []int)

func (*AlarmMgrShowAlarmData) GetAid

func (m *AlarmMgrShowAlarmData) GetAid() string

func (*AlarmMgrShowAlarmData) GetAlarmName

func (m *AlarmMgrShowAlarmData) GetAlarmName() string

func (*AlarmMgrShowAlarmData) GetClearTime

func (m *AlarmMgrShowAlarmData) GetClearTime() string

func (*AlarmMgrShowAlarmData) GetClearTimestamp

func (m *AlarmMgrShowAlarmData) GetClearTimestamp() uint64

func (*AlarmMgrShowAlarmData) GetDescription

func (m *AlarmMgrShowAlarmData) GetDescription() string

func (*AlarmMgrShowAlarmData) GetEid

func (m *AlarmMgrShowAlarmData) GetEid() string

func (*AlarmMgrShowAlarmData) GetGroup

func (m *AlarmMgrShowAlarmData) GetGroup() string

func (*AlarmMgrShowAlarmData) GetInterface

func (m *AlarmMgrShowAlarmData) GetInterface() string

func (*AlarmMgrShowAlarmData) GetLocation

func (m *AlarmMgrShowAlarmData) GetLocation() string

func (*AlarmMgrShowAlarmData) GetModule

func (m *AlarmMgrShowAlarmData) GetModule() string

func (*AlarmMgrShowAlarmData) GetOtn

func (m *AlarmMgrShowAlarmData) GetOtn() *AlarmOtn

func (*AlarmMgrShowAlarmData) GetPendingSync

func (m *AlarmMgrShowAlarmData) GetPendingSync() bool

func (*AlarmMgrShowAlarmData) GetReportingAgentId

func (m *AlarmMgrShowAlarmData) GetReportingAgentId() uint32

func (*AlarmMgrShowAlarmData) GetServiceAffecting

func (m *AlarmMgrShowAlarmData) GetServiceAffecting() string

func (*AlarmMgrShowAlarmData) GetSetTime

func (m *AlarmMgrShowAlarmData) GetSetTime() string

func (*AlarmMgrShowAlarmData) GetSetTimestamp

func (m *AlarmMgrShowAlarmData) GetSetTimestamp() uint64

func (*AlarmMgrShowAlarmData) GetSeverity

func (m *AlarmMgrShowAlarmData) GetSeverity() string

func (*AlarmMgrShowAlarmData) GetStatus

func (m *AlarmMgrShowAlarmData) GetStatus() string

func (*AlarmMgrShowAlarmData) GetTag

func (m *AlarmMgrShowAlarmData) GetTag() string

func (*AlarmMgrShowAlarmData) GetTca

func (m *AlarmMgrShowAlarmData) GetTca() *AlarmTca

func (*AlarmMgrShowAlarmData) GetType

func (m *AlarmMgrShowAlarmData) GetType() string

func (*AlarmMgrShowAlarmData) ProtoMessage

func (*AlarmMgrShowAlarmData) ProtoMessage()

func (*AlarmMgrShowAlarmData) Reset

func (m *AlarmMgrShowAlarmData) Reset()

func (*AlarmMgrShowAlarmData) String

func (m *AlarmMgrShowAlarmData) String() string

func (*AlarmMgrShowAlarmData) XXX_DiscardUnknown

func (m *AlarmMgrShowAlarmData) XXX_DiscardUnknown()

func (*AlarmMgrShowAlarmData) XXX_Marshal

func (m *AlarmMgrShowAlarmData) XXX_Marshal(b []byte, deterministic bool) ([]byte, error)

func (*AlarmMgrShowAlarmData) XXX_Merge

func (dst *AlarmMgrShowAlarmData) XXX_Merge(src proto.Message)

func (*AlarmMgrShowAlarmData) XXX_Size

func (m *AlarmMgrShowAlarmData) XXX_Size() int

func (*AlarmMgrShowAlarmData) XXX_Unmarshal

func (m *AlarmMgrShowAlarmData) XXX_Unmarshal(b []byte) error

type AlarmMgrShowAlarmInfoCli

type AlarmMgrShowAlarmInfoCli struct {
	// Alarm List
	AlarmInfo            []*AlarmMgrShowAlarmData `protobuf:"bytes,50,rep,name=alarm_info,json=alarmInfo,proto3" json:"alarm_info,omitempty"`
	XXX_NoUnkeyedLiteral struct{}                 `json:"-"`
	XXX_unrecognized     []byte                   `json:"-"`
	XXX_sizecache        int32                    `json:"-"`
}

func (*AlarmMgrShowAlarmInfoCli) Descriptor

func (*AlarmMgrShowAlarmInfoCli) Descriptor() ([]byte, []int)

func (*AlarmMgrShowAlarmInfoCli) GetAlarmInfo

func (m *AlarmMgrShowAlarmInfoCli) GetAlarmInfo() []*AlarmMgrShowAlarmData

func (*AlarmMgrShowAlarmInfoCli) ProtoMessage

func (*AlarmMgrShowAlarmInfoCli) ProtoMessage()

func (*AlarmMgrShowAlarmInfoCli) Reset

func (m *AlarmMgrShowAlarmInfoCli) Reset()

func (*AlarmMgrShowAlarmInfoCli) String

func (m *AlarmMgrShowAlarmInfoCli) String() string

func (*AlarmMgrShowAlarmInfoCli) XXX_DiscardUnknown

func (m *AlarmMgrShowAlarmInfoCli) XXX_DiscardUnknown()

func (*AlarmMgrShowAlarmInfoCli) XXX_Marshal

func (m *AlarmMgrShowAlarmInfoCli) XXX_Marshal(b []byte, deterministic bool) ([]byte, error)

func (*AlarmMgrShowAlarmInfoCli) XXX_Merge

func (dst *AlarmMgrShowAlarmInfoCli) XXX_Merge(src proto.Message)

func (*AlarmMgrShowAlarmInfoCli) XXX_Size

func (m *AlarmMgrShowAlarmInfoCli) XXX_Size() int

func (*AlarmMgrShowAlarmInfoCli) XXX_Unmarshal

func (m *AlarmMgrShowAlarmInfoCli) XXX_Unmarshal(b []byte) error

type AlarmMgrShowAlarmInfoCli_KEYS

type AlarmMgrShowAlarmInfoCli_KEYS struct {
	NodeId               string   `protobuf:"bytes,1,opt,name=node_id,json=nodeId,proto3" json:"node_id,omitempty"`
	XXX_NoUnkeyedLiteral struct{} `json:"-"`
	XXX_unrecognized     []byte   `json:"-"`
	XXX_sizecache        int32    `json:"-"`
}

alarm mgr show alarm info for CLI

func (*AlarmMgrShowAlarmInfoCli_KEYS) Descriptor

func (*AlarmMgrShowAlarmInfoCli_KEYS) Descriptor() ([]byte, []int)

func (*AlarmMgrShowAlarmInfoCli_KEYS) GetNodeId

func (m *AlarmMgrShowAlarmInfoCli_KEYS) GetNodeId() string

func (*AlarmMgrShowAlarmInfoCli_KEYS) ProtoMessage

func (*AlarmMgrShowAlarmInfoCli_KEYS) ProtoMessage()

func (*AlarmMgrShowAlarmInfoCli_KEYS) Reset

func (m *AlarmMgrShowAlarmInfoCli_KEYS) Reset()

func (*AlarmMgrShowAlarmInfoCli_KEYS) String

func (*AlarmMgrShowAlarmInfoCli_KEYS) XXX_DiscardUnknown

func (m *AlarmMgrShowAlarmInfoCli_KEYS) XXX_DiscardUnknown()

func (*AlarmMgrShowAlarmInfoCli_KEYS) XXX_Marshal

func (m *AlarmMgrShowAlarmInfoCli_KEYS) XXX_Marshal(b []byte, deterministic bool) ([]byte, error)

func (*AlarmMgrShowAlarmInfoCli_KEYS) XXX_Merge

func (dst *AlarmMgrShowAlarmInfoCli_KEYS) XXX_Merge(src proto.Message)

func (*AlarmMgrShowAlarmInfoCli_KEYS) XXX_Size

func (m *AlarmMgrShowAlarmInfoCli_KEYS) XXX_Size() int

func (*AlarmMgrShowAlarmInfoCli_KEYS) XXX_Unmarshal

func (m *AlarmMgrShowAlarmInfoCli_KEYS) XXX_Unmarshal(b []byte) error

type AlarmOtn

type AlarmOtn struct {
	// Alarm direction
	Direction string `protobuf:"bytes,1,opt,name=direction,proto3" json:"direction,omitempty"`
	// Source of Alarm
	NotificationSource   string   `protobuf:"bytes,2,opt,name=notification_source,json=notificationSource,proto3" json:"notification_source,omitempty"`
	XXX_NoUnkeyedLiteral struct{} `json:"-"`
	XXX_unrecognized     []byte   `json:"-"`
	XXX_sizecache        int32    `json:"-"`
}

Alarm transport attributes

func (*AlarmOtn) Descriptor

func (*AlarmOtn) Descriptor() ([]byte, []int)

func (*AlarmOtn) GetDirection

func (m *AlarmOtn) GetDirection() string

func (*AlarmOtn) GetNotificationSource

func (m *AlarmOtn) GetNotificationSource() string

func (*AlarmOtn) ProtoMessage

func (*AlarmOtn) ProtoMessage()

func (*AlarmOtn) Reset

func (m *AlarmOtn) Reset()

func (*AlarmOtn) String

func (m *AlarmOtn) String() string

func (*AlarmOtn) XXX_DiscardUnknown

func (m *AlarmOtn) XXX_DiscardUnknown()

func (*AlarmOtn) XXX_Marshal

func (m *AlarmOtn) XXX_Marshal(b []byte, deterministic bool) ([]byte, error)

func (*AlarmOtn) XXX_Merge

func (dst *AlarmOtn) XXX_Merge(src proto.Message)

func (*AlarmOtn) XXX_Size

func (m *AlarmOtn) XXX_Size() int

func (*AlarmOtn) XXX_Unmarshal

func (m *AlarmOtn) XXX_Unmarshal(b []byte) error

type AlarmTca

type AlarmTca struct {
	// Alarm Threshold
	ThresholdValue string `protobuf:"bytes,1,opt,name=threshold_value,json=thresholdValue,proto3" json:"threshold_value,omitempty"`
	// Alarm Threshold
	CurrentValue string `protobuf:"bytes,2,opt,name=current_value,json=currentValue,proto3" json:"current_value,omitempty"`
	// Timing Bucket
	BucketType           string   `protobuf:"bytes,3,opt,name=bucket_type,json=bucketType,proto3" json:"bucket_type,omitempty"`
	XXX_NoUnkeyedLiteral struct{} `json:"-"`
	XXX_unrecognized     []byte   `json:"-"`
	XXX_sizecache        int32    `json:"-"`
}

Alarm TCA Attributes

func (*AlarmTca) Descriptor

func (*AlarmTca) Descriptor() ([]byte, []int)

func (*AlarmTca) GetBucketType

func (m *AlarmTca) GetBucketType() string

func (*AlarmTca) GetCurrentValue

func (m *AlarmTca) GetCurrentValue() string

func (*AlarmTca) GetThresholdValue

func (m *AlarmTca) GetThresholdValue() string

func (*AlarmTca) ProtoMessage

func (*AlarmTca) ProtoMessage()

func (*AlarmTca) Reset

func (m *AlarmTca) Reset()

func (*AlarmTca) String

func (m *AlarmTca) String() string

func (*AlarmTca) XXX_DiscardUnknown

func (m *AlarmTca) XXX_DiscardUnknown()

func (*AlarmTca) XXX_Marshal

func (m *AlarmTca) XXX_Marshal(b []byte, deterministic bool) ([]byte, error)

func (*AlarmTca) XXX_Merge

func (dst *AlarmTca) XXX_Merge(src proto.Message)

func (*AlarmTca) XXX_Size

func (m *AlarmTca) XXX_Size() int

func (*AlarmTca) XXX_Unmarshal

func (m *AlarmTca) XXX_Unmarshal(b []byte) error

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L